Abstract

Introduction - This report was designed in the scope of the “Final Internship and Report” Curricular Unit of the Master’s in Nursing, with specialization in Community Nursing – Community Health and Public Health at the Institute of Health Sciences, Porto, Universidade Católica. The internship occurred in a Public Health Unit of a Health Center Group integrated in a Local Health Unit. It was carried out in a learning, development, and knowledge integration scope for advanced nursing care to a community and to a population. The phenomenon under study concerns the Epidemiological Surveillance of Nursing Diagnoses in chronic disease (in the continuity of other studies carried out in that Public Health Unit), framed in the integration of care in one of its dimensions – Information Systems (and respective sharing) and Community Nursing Empowerment for the translation of measurable gains. Methodology - The analysis of the study focused on the use of Health Planning, integrating in the Project the clinical decision matrix – Model of Assessment, Intervention and Community Empowerment and in the Nursing Diagnosis Observatory of the Health Center Group where the Final Internship was carried out. A questionnaire was used as data collection instrument, applied to a determined intentional sample in agreement with experts. Results - It was identified as priority intervention target problems the need to improve the communication of the organizational structure for the management of chronic disease, effectively knowing about Information Systems and the activity of Epidemiological Surveillance of Nursing Diagnoses of the Nursing Diagnosis Observatory of the Health Center Group. It was found that there are training needs in the community nursing leaders in chronic disease for clinical nursing documentation in Nursing Information Systems.
